Evidence-Grounded Constraint Checking in Construction Documents

A new study published on arXiv proposes an innovative method for enhancing verification in document assessments within the construction industry. The research focuses on standardizing data collection and incorporates four precise rules to manage source citations and unresolved matters. An analysis involving 160 tasks across 29 construction projects demonstrated a 10.6% boost in decision-making accuracy when a method was refined to include specific image layouts. However, a wider evaluation revealed a slight decline in accuracy for a particular methodology. This investigation underscores the critical role of effective evidence management in streamlining document review processes in this sector.

Key facts

  • Paper arXiv:2607.29058 presents an evidence-grounded pipeline for constraint checking in construction documents.
  • The pipeline normalizes extracted facts, executes four-state rules deterministically, retains source spans, and escalates unresolved cases.
  • Evaluation used 160 reference-based tasks from 29 construction projects.
  • Reallocating a four-image budget to one overview and three overlapping tiles improved decision accuracy by 10.6 percentage points.
  • The improvement was statistically significant (95% CI: 4.3 to 18.0; exact p = 0.031).
  • The effect did not persist in a broader block: Region-RAG changed accuracy by -4.1 points (95% CI: -10.2 to 1.9; exact p = 0.209).
  • An equal-image sensitivity favored the original approach.
  • The study focuses on evidence allocation in automated document review for construction projects.
